Web29 jun. 2024 · Uncooked and unrolled pastry dough - Make the healthy vegan pie dough up to 3 days ahead. Place in a tightly sealed freezer bag, airtight container or wrap tightly and thoroughly in cling wrap and place in the fridge until needed. It can also be frozen for up to 3 months. Remove the pan from the oven, and carefully lift out the foil/parchment and weights and set them … Web9 jul. 2024 · Make an egg wash by whisking one egg yolk and 1 tablespoon of heavy cream in a small bowl. Remove beans (or pie weights) and foil from pie crust. Brush the bottom and sides of the crust with egg wash. Bake until egg wash is dry and shiny, for about 4 minutes. Cool crust completely before filling.

Pour it in the … citi field ticket office phoneWeb14 mrt. 2024 · A lot of people are intimidated by homemade pie dough for chicken pot pie. Don’t be. Homemade pie crust is actually easy to make, and the flavor and texture of a buttery pie crust here is worth the effort. Mostly you just have to 1) not overwork the dough, and 2) let it rest.
